In 1928 the Nazis were a small party, but in 1932 - 37% of vote. Economic crisis made the Nazis more appealing 

Economic Impact of the WSC (1929) 

US economy experienced depression - german economy heavily dependent on US loans, therefore in Germany:

- National income shrunk by 39% 1929-1932 

- Industrial production declined by more than 40% 

- Unemployment rose to 6 million by 1932  

- 50,000 businesses bankrupt 

- 1931, banking crisis - 5 major banks went bankrupt 

- Living standard vastly decreased - desperation
